Policy Advisory Systems and Governance Dynamics

Summary

Policy advisory systems encompass the formal and informal mechanisms through which expert knowledge, stakeholder perspectives and data‐driven insights are channelled into decision-making processes. Governance dynamics describe how these advisory inputs interact with institutional structures, political actors and societal demands to shape policy trajectories. Central themes include the composition and mandate of expert bodies, the modalities of information exchange and the mechanisms that embed feedback and learning into governance frameworks. Technological advances—particularly in artificial intelligence and digital platforms—have expanded the capacity for real-time analysis and scenario modelling, while also raising new questions about transparency, accountability and bias. Comparative studies reveal that networked governance arrangements, which link multiple stakeholders across sectors, often enhance adaptive capacity and legitimacy, whereas more centralised advisory commissions can provide streamlined coherence in specialised policy domains. Practical applications span epidemic control, climate adaptation and urban development, illustrating how integrated advisory-governance architectures can deliver more resilient and responsive public policy.

Technical terms

Policy advisory system: An institutional or networked arrangement through which expert advice and stakeholder input inform policy decisions.

Network governance: A model of decision-making characterised by interdependent actors collaborating across formal and informal structures.

Epistemic community: A network of professionals recognised for expertise in a particular domain, sharing normative and causal beliefs.

Algorithmic bias: Systematic errors in machine-based decision rules that produce unfair or discriminatory outcomes.
